Water and power outages have become commonplace, and street and traffic lights seldom work.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Years of neglect and underinvestment forced City Power to implement load reduction to prevent its power systems and infrastructure from collapsing.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>There are also regular power outages due to cable theft and substation problems. Better management could prevent these.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Board chair Bonolo Ramokhele said the network&#8217;s issues stemmed from its age and estimated that it would cost R50 billion to fix the century-old infrastructure.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>An equally serious problem is regular water outages, threatening instability and unrest in South Africa\u2019s largest city.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Crumbling infrastructure has caused prolonged water outages, hurting households and businesses in the city.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>To address these problems, Rand Water has started to conduct substantial maintenance on parts of the water network. This caused further outages.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Last week, News24 reported that Johannesburg is grappling with severe water shortages, affecting over half its population, due to ongoing maintenance.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Johannesburg\u2019s water infrastructure has not kept pace with its rapid population growth and cannot cope with increased demand.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Johannesburg needs R25 billion to fix its water infrastructure and potentially billions more to replace outdated equipment to meet increasing demand.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The problems do not stop at electricity and water. Traffic lights are often out, and streetlights do not work on many major routes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>It is common to see unemployed people directing traffic at busy intersections due to traffic light problems.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The city is also beset with crime and corruption, causing many businesses and rich households to leave for the Western Cape.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>It is difficult to fight corruption as it has infiltrated most aspects of the city, including law enforcement.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>This month, City of Johannesburg official Zenzele Benedict Sithole was killed in a hit.
